Sam McIntosh
(born 13 July 1990) is an Australian Paralympic athlete who races in the T52 100m, 200m, and 400m events. He holds 3 Australian National Records and 2 Oceania Records. He represented Australia at the
2012 London Paralympic Games
,
2016 Rio Paralympics
and
2020 Tokyo Paralympics
in athletics as well as the
2011
,
2015
,
2017
,
2019
and
2023
Para Athletic World Championships. He has been selected for the
2024 Paris Paralympics
- his fourth Games.
